Output 8763083c9609cef5693431ac3c34f665423c6308717d021b18a53210ff87ed57:23

value
84215
script pubkey
OP_0 OP_PUSHBYTES_20 b5e7369681319d3f24ff8c8aeb646a1d94f88a91
address
bc1qkhnnd95pxxwn7f8l3j9wker2rk203z5340yz5e
transaction
8763083c9609cef5693431ac3c34f665423c6308717d021b18a53210ff87ed57
confirmations
796
spent
true